Transaction 13f9516a3bbb0cf531899bbfcdf82c75f00b3943f25ece6405a185c7a855fe4c
1 Input
1 Output
-
13f9516a3bbb0cf531899bbfcdf82c75f00b3943f25ece6405a185c7a855fe4c:0
- value
- 3378779
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4acc70a82948e3b5af33dd558db2bba50ca213b7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17pVuwY2g6ax7gdwXMr4vPMHMydvaBL4gv